Nettet14. apr. 2024 · Use an antibacterial mouthwash: Rinse your mouth with an antibacterial mouthwash to help prevent infection and reduce plaque buildup; Avoid hard or sticky foods: Avoid hard or sticky foods that can damage the implant or surrounding gums. Instead, eat a healthy and balanced diet that is rich in f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ins;

Rinse your mouth with an antibacterial mouthwash to help kill bacteria and freshen your breath. Look for a mouthwash that is specifically designed for dental implants, as some mouthwashes can contain alcohol or other harsh ingredients that may damage the implant.
